Output 9939af311044f0eac90e06249e29b1bcef0fac79403331001538d9d809c835e2:0

value
28900154646
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0ba409b3f51ae1061cda6d7cea8b1181a3e2e25f OP_EQUALVERIFY OP_CHECKSIG
address
124YwfUeWJ6DGoNKZAhNfRKCNjPcvPTpPK
transaction
9939af311044f0eac90e06249e29b1bcef0fac79403331001538d9d809c835e2
confirmations
651792
spent
true